SqlBak features and specs

  • Ease of Setup
    SqlBak offers a straightforward setup process, allowing users to quickly configure backups and monitoring for their SQL databases without needing extensive technical knowledge.
  • Automated Backups
    The platform provides automated backup scheduling, ensuring that your database backups are performed regularly and reducing the risk of data loss.
  • Data Security
    SqlBak encrypts backups both during transmission and at rest, providing a secure solution to protect sensitive database information from unauthorized access.
  • Monitoring and Alerts
    Users receive real-time monitoring and alerts for their SQL servers, helping them quickly identify and address potential issues.
  • Cross-Platform Compatibility
    SqlBak supports various SQL database systems, including SQL Server, MySQL, and PostgreSQL, providing flexibility for different environments.

Possible disadvantages of SqlBak

  • Limited Free Plan
    The free version of SqlBak has some limitations, which may not be sufficient for larger businesses or those with more complex needs.
  • Dependency on Internet
    Since SqlBak is a cloud-based service, it relies on an internet connection to perform backups and monitoring, which could be an issue in environments with unreliable network access.
  • Complex Restores
    Restoring backups may require more manual intervention compared to other solutions, depending on the specific database and setup.
  • Pricing
    For full functionality, a paid subscription is required, which might be costly for small businesses or individuals with limited budgets.
  • Limited Advanced Features
    While suitable for standard backup and monitoring, SqlBak might lack some of the advanced features or customizations that large enterprises require.

R-Crypto features and specs

  • Strong Encryption
    R-Crypto offers robust encryption algorithms that help protect sensitive data from unauthorized access.
  • Easy to Use Interface
    The software features a user-friendly interface, making it accessible even for users without extensive technical knowledge.
  • Wide Compatibility
    R-Crypto is compatible with various operating systems, allowing for flexibility in different computing environments.
  • Real-time Encryption
    It provides real-time encryption, ensuring that any data changes are immediately encrypted, protecting it at all times.

Possible disadvantages of R-Crypto

  • Limited Advanced Features
    Compared to some competitors, R-Crypto may lack certain advanced features like cloud integration or multi-user support.
  • Potential Performance Overhead
    The encryption process can introduce some performance overhead, which might affect system speed depending on usage and hardware.
  • Cost
    R-Crypto may come with licensing fees that could be considered high for individual users or small businesses.
  • Support Limitations
    Some users may find the technical support options limited, especially if they require immediate or extensive assistance.
